N Joel's recipe for lemonade the ratio of lemons to water is 7 to 4. People are complaining that the lemonade is too weak. Which ratio would make the lemonade STRONGER?
A) 5 to 3
B) 7 to 5
C) 8 to 4
D) 8 to 5

C) 8 to 4
All of the others increase the amount of water or decrease the amount of lemon
